2

在 CellTable 的展示示例中:http://gwt.google.com/samples/Showcase/Showcase.html#! CwCellTable

可以单击(最右侧)地址列,该行变为黄色,单元格为灰色框。通过按 UP 和 DOWN 键,我可以选择不同的行,并且地址被框起来。通过点击 LEFT 和 RIGHT 键,可以在不同列的灰色单元格中进行构图。

但是... 使用 LEFT 或 RIGHT 键离开地址栏后,无法返回。跳过地址列,可能是因为它不可编辑或其他原因。

有没有办法让键盘可以访问不可编辑的列?我知道这可能没有用,但我有一张类似的桌子,我觉得这种行为很烦人。

4

1 回答 1

3

查看 的代码AbstractCellTable,如果列是“交互式”的,即如果Cell消耗一些事件,它只会在处理左/右键时将焦点移动到列。在展示中,地址列使用TextCell不处理任何事件的 a,因此无法使用键盘将焦点移动到该列。

于 2012-09-03T20:33:54.917 回答